Shockstop Seatpost

Philadelphia based RedShift Sports has released the ShockStop Seatpost, an adjustable-stiffness suspension seatpost that smooths out your bicycle ride. Simply replace the existing rigid seatpost on your bike with the ShockStop for an adjustable-stiffness suspension seatpost which will effortlessly smooth out your ride. The innovative device lets you ride faster and more efficiently by keeping you stable and allowing the bike to absorb rough terrain. watch the video below
